What are Baby Nasal Drops and Why Do You Need Them?

So, what exactly are baby nasal drops? Simply put, they're saline solutions designed to gently clear your baby's nasal passages. They come in convenient little bottles and are super easy to use. The main goal is to loosen up and thin the mucus that's causing the congestion, making it easier for your baby to breathe and, therefore, feel much better. Think of it like a gentle flush for their tiny noses, helping to remove irritants like allergens, dust, and of course, those pesky cold and flu germs. Plus, unlike some medications, these drops are generally safe for even the youngest babies, including newborns. They are a go-to solution for many parents. They can alleviate symptoms and prevent further complications, like ear infections or difficulty feeding.

Why do you need them? Well, babies can't blow their noses. You have to help them! When a baby's nose is blocked, it can cause all sorts of problems. Difficulty breathing, which can disrupt sleep and make them cranky. Trouble feeding, as they can't latch on properly when they can't breathe through their noses. And even an increased risk of infections, as the trapped mucus can become a breeding ground for bacteria. Baby nasal drops help address all of these issues. They're a quick and effective way to provide relief, and are often the first line of defense for a stuffy nose. Using Baby Nasal Drops Safely and Effectively

Okay, so you've got your baby nasal drops – now what? Using them safely and effectively is super important to ensure your baby gets the relief they need without any problems. First things first, always read the product instructions carefully before use. Different brands might have slightly different recommendations, so it's best to be informed. Most baby nasal drops are simple to administer. You'll typically find that the instructions recommend you lay your baby on their back, gently tilt their head back, and place a few drops into each nostril. Some drops come with a dropper or a spray nozzle. Regardless, make sure you don't insert the dropper too far into the nostril to avoid causing any discomfort or injury. After administering the drops, you might notice your baby sneeze or cough a bit. This is completely normal and means the drops are working to loosen the mucus. You can use a bulb syringe or a nasal aspirator to gently remove the loosened mucus. This will help clear the nasal passages. It is important to clean the dropper or nozzle after each use. This will prevent contamination. Ensure to store the drops correctly. They should be stored at room temperature, away from direct sunlight and out of reach of children. Key Ingredients to Look For

When choosing baby nasal drops, it's helpful to know what to look for on the ingredient list. The most important ingredient is generally saline solution. This is a mixture of sterile water and sodium chloride (salt). It’s the active ingredient that helps to clear congestion. Saline solution is safe, gentle, and effective. It’s also often preservative-free, which is great for sensitive babies. Some products may include additional ingredients. These are for added benefits. Glycerin is a common ingredient. It helps moisturize dry nasal passages. It is especially helpful during the dry winter months. Aloe vera is another ingredient. It is known for its soothing properties. It is included to reduce irritation and inflammation. You'll want to avoid products with harsh chemicals, such as decongestants or preservatives, unless your pediatrician recommends them. These can sometimes cause side effects or irritation in sensitive babies. Fragrances and dyes should also be avoided. They can trigger allergic reactions. Always check the label. Beyond Drops: Other Remedies for Stuffy Noses

While baby nasal drops are a fantastic first step, there are other remedies you can try to help your baby feel better when they have a stuffy nose. One of the most helpful tools is a nasal aspirator (also known as a bulb syringe). After using the drops, this device helps to gently suction out the loosened mucus from your baby's nose. It provides instant relief. Humidifiers are also great. They add moisture to the air. This helps to loosen congestion and soothe irritated nasal passages. Place a humidifier in your baby’s room. You’ll see a difference. Be sure to keep the humidifier clean to prevent mold growth. Elevating your baby’s head while they sleep can help. Place a rolled-up towel or pillow under the mattress, so their head is slightly elevated. This helps to drain the sinuses and make breathing easier. Frequent feeding or offering extra fluids can also help. Hydration thins mucus and can make it easier to clear. If your baby is older, you can try gently wiping their nose with a soft, clean cloth. This can help remove any excess mucus and keep them comfortable. Avoid using cough and cold medicines without consulting with your pediatrician. These medications can sometimes have side effects. Consult your doctor first. Remember to always create a comfortable and relaxing environment for your baby. Minimize exposure to irritants like smoke and strong odors. Keep the room at a comfortable temperature. Combining these additional remedies with nasal drops can provide comprehensive relief. It will make your baby feel better. When to See a Doctor

While baby nasal drops and other remedies can effectively treat most cases of nasal congestion, there are times when it’s essential to seek medical advice. If your baby is struggling to breathe, showing signs of difficulty breathing, or has rapid breathing, seek immediate medical attention. These symptoms could indicate a more serious respiratory issue. If your baby has a fever, especially if it’s high (over 100.4°F or 38°C), consult your doctor. A fever could be a sign of infection. If your baby has a persistent cough, especially one that produces thick or discolored mucus, it's wise to consult a doctor. This could be a sign of a more severe illness like bronchitis or pneumonia. Any signs of an ear infection, such as pulling at the ears, fussiness, or fever, should be evaluated by a medical professional. Ear infections often accompany respiratory infections. If your baby isn’t feeding well or is refusing to eat, and has a stuffy nose, it’s important to seek medical advice. A stuffy nose can make it difficult for babies to feed. Seek medical help. Trust your instincts. If you are concerned about your baby’s condition, or if their symptoms worsen or don't improve after a few days, it's always best to consult your pediatrician. They can assess your baby and provide the appropriate care. When in doubt, always seek professional medical advice. Addressing health concerns is important for your baby.
